The soup is a variation of vegetable soup. This one is full of garlic, leeks, tomatoes, chickpeas, zucchini and spinach. We keep everything really rustic in this hearty soup. But the real star of the meal was the sandwich, or if you please, the Panini. We got the bread from a local bakery, and then thinly sliced salami, ham, and provolone from the butcher. Sergio made an olive dressing from chopped green olives, olive oil, vinegar, salt, oregano, and pepper. And we finished it off with spicy mustard and a few minutes under the grill to make the cheese all melty.
